Cast in resin and lovingly hand painted and finished by Bali artisans. It also called Namaskara Mudra this represents the gesture of greeting, prayer and adoration. Light a candle and give your guests a truly zen welcome. 17x9x9 (cm)
top of page
£15.99Price
VAT Included
Related Products
bottom of page